Biography:
— Senator from Texas.
— Born in Houston, Texas, on February 2, 1952.
— B.A., Trinity University 1973.
— J.D., St. Mary's School of Law 1977.
— LLM, University of Virginia 1995.
— Attorney.
— Bexar County district court judge 1984-1990.
— Texas supreme court 1990-1997.
— Texas state attorney general 1999-2002.
— Elected as a Republican to the U.S. Senate in 2002.
— Subsequently appointed to the remainder of the term left vacant by the resignation of William Philip Gramm, and took the oath of office on December 2, 2002.
— Reelected in 2008, 2014, and again in 2020 for the term ending January 3, 2027.
— Republican Conference vice-chair (2007-2009).
— Chair, National Republican Senatorial Committee (2009-2012).
— Republican party whip (2013-2018).
